About the program
EACH is thrilled to announce the launch of our headspace Early Psychosis (hEP) service in Tasmania! This groundbreaking program aims to revolutionize mental health care by providing early detection and intervention for young individuals (aged 12-25) who are at risk of, or experiencing, a first episode of psychosis.

About the role
We are seeking an experienced and dynamic Manager to oversee our headspace Early Psychosis Tasmanian Service. As the Manager – headspace Early Psychosis, you will work closely with the Clinical Director, our new headspace to be established on Hobart’s eastern shore and lead agencies of headspace Hobart and Launceston to ensure the safe and effective delivery of mental health services to young people and their families.

As part of the Senior Management team across Tasmania, we envisage this role will be primarily based in Launceston. Travel across Hobart, Burnie and Devonport may also be required.

Key responsibilities:

  • Oversee hEP service delivery in the north and south of the state
  • Enhance access for young people and families through a streamlined entry process
  • Support the implementation and maintenance of the EPPIC model of care with fidelity
  • Establish effective clinical systems and processes to enhance service delivery
  • Provide day-to-day operational oversight to clinical team leaders
  • Work collaboratively with the Clinical Director hEP and headspace teams to ensure effective clinical care for clients and families
